The socio-economic aspect in a technical plan refers to the consideration of how a project will impact the social and economic conditions of the community it affects. This includes analyzing potential job creation, improvements in living standards, and the overall economic benefits or drawbacks of the project. By integrating socio-economic factors, planners aim to ensure that the technical solutions proposed not only meet operational goals but also contribute positively to societal well-being and economic growth.
